For your review: the extraction script crawls our template repos nightly and pushes candidate strings to the Verdangle translation queue. It runs under a scoped service account with read-only repo access; write access is limited to the queue bucket. Known gap: it logs full template paths, which occasionally include internal project codenames — flagged but not fixed. No user data touches this pipeline. Output is signed before upload. The script reads its runtime configuration from a mounted file containing the following values:

config for tagep-yajef:
ulawyn:
  log_level: error
  metrics_host: metrics.ulawyn.lumiclabs.internal
  pin: 0564
  pool_size: 32

Ticket: Drift on export retry settings

Found config drift between the Burrowline export workers in region-east and region-west. East retries failed exports with exponential backoff; west still uses the deprecated fixed-interval retry, causing duplicate batches downstream. No code change needed — this is pure config. Reviewer: please confirm the canonical values match what's in the runbook before I sync both regions. The intended canonical retry configuration is the following.

deployment values, taweg-bajop:
[fenvan]
port = 5672
team = holmir
host = fenvan.orvexio.example
region = lower-1
access_code = ac_b98bc6
timeout_ms = 1500

# Northvale Region — Q3 Sales Review (Managers Only)

Northvale closed the quarter at 94% of target, driven by steady Harlock Systems renewals and a late push on the Pendrel appliance line. Kestwick branch underperformed due to staffing gaps; Dunmore overdelivered on upsells. Discounting averaged 8%, within policy. Finance should note that pipeline coverage for Q4 sits at 2.1x, slightly below the 2.5x benchmark. The confidential outlook for next year appears below.

confidential, kagup-bafog: Fraaxax Group is in early talks to buy Soroxox Group for about $343.8 million. The Olidor launch date is June 14, and nothing goes to the press before then. Legal wants the Aldmirek Logistics term sheet signed before July 23.

**Ticket #SUP — Read-replica lag alarm keeps firing**

The Cobblestream replica lag alarm has been paging every night around the batch import window. We've bumped the threshold from 30s to 120s during that window and want support's blessing before closing. Needs a sign-off from the engineer on the hook for replica health, listed below.

signatory, fafog-bagef: Jorwyn Juleth Pelius